Grooved carpetshell

Order Venerida
Family Veneridae

Marine bivalve mollusc. An oblong shell, longer than high. Adorned by fine radial lines, which cut the transverse grooves, that are numerous, concentric and thin. Hinge with 3 teeth per valve. The color is yellowish, greenish or grey, with dark rays. It measures up to 8 cm.

International denominations
Germany Grosse Teppichmuschel
France Palourde
Italy Vongola verace
Portugal Amêijoa boa
United Kingdom Grooved carpetshell
